Out And About In Penrith And Local Area

Penrith market town is located in the Eden valley which is seen as the gateway to the Northern part of the Lake District. On the outskirts of Penrith on the A66 toward Keswick you can find the Rheged Discovery   Centre. This is a very popular attraction that is built into a hill which is a must see in itself. It has a number of shops, exhibitions and a cinema. Rheged is open daily to visitors.
